ROSEMARY AND CHEDDAR SODA BREADS
Provided by Food Network
Time 45m
Yield 4 breads
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F. Lightly oil a baking sheet or line with parchment paper.
- Sift the flours, baking soda and salt together in a bowl. Stir in the Cheddar and chopped rosemary. Make a well in the middle. Add the buttermilk and, using a fork, mix until just combined. This will give you a soft, sticky dough, which makes a nice moist loaf. With floured hands, divide the dough into 4, scrape each one onto the prepared baking sheet and pat into a light round. Using a chef's knife, deeply score each soda bread with a cross on top (this will allow the heat to penetrate the center of the dough).
- Bake until the breads are dark golden all over and sound hollow when you tap the bottoms, about 30 minutes.
IRISH SODA BREAD WITH CHEDDAR AND CHIVES
Provided by Valerie Bertinelli
Time 1h10m
Yield 1 loaf
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F and line a rimmed ba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Add the fl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, garlic powder, onion powder and pepper to a large bowl. Whisk to break up any lumps of flour. Add the Cheddar and chives. Stir to evenly combine the ingredients. Set aside.
- Add the buttermilk and egg to a 2-cup measuring cup. Use a fork to scramble the egg into the buttermilk.
- Add the buttermilk mixture to the bowl with the flour mixture and use a rubber spatula to mix the ingredients until a shaggy dough forms. Turn the dough out onto a lightly floured work surface. Lightly flour your hands and knead the dough until it comes together, about 1 minute. Flip the dough so that it is seam-side down and transfer it to the prepared baking sheet. Use a serrated knife to cut a 1/2-inch-thick X on the top of the dough.
- Bake until the bread is golden brown, 25 to 30 minutes.
- Let cool slightly on a wire rack before slicing.

ROSEMARY-PARMESAN SODA BREAD
Nutty Parmesan and aromatic rosemary add unexpected flavor to this delightful twist on Irish soda bread. The easy, no-yeast bread is great for breakfast, lunch or dinner. Be sure to let the bread cool at least 10 minutes before slicing. It can be served warm or at room temperature along with softened butter and a sprinkling of flaky salt.
Provided by Justin Chapple
Categories side-dish
Time 1h30m
Yield 8 servings
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F. Line a large cast-iron skillet with parchment paper.
- In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, Parmesan, sugar, rosemary, kosher salt, baking powder, baking soda and red pepper flakes. Working over the bowl, grate the butter on the large holes of a box grater, letting the grated butter fall over the flour mixture. Gently toss the butter into the flour. Using a fork, stir in the buttermilk until a shaggy dough forms.
- Scrape the dough onto a work surface, gather up any crumbs and knead gently until the dough just comes together. Shape the dough into a round loaf and transfer it to the prepared skillet. Slash an X about 1/4 inch deep in the top of the bread. Brush the bread with buttermilk, then sprinkle with Parmesan and pepper.
- Bake the bread until it is golden and it sounds hollow when lightly tapped, 45 to 50 minutes. Transfer the bread to a wire rack and let cool at least 10 minutes. Serve warm or at room temperature with softened butter and flaky sea salt.
